
Boris Mihailović
Boris Mihailović is the director of Barska plovidba, a maritime company that is exploring collaborative solutions with Crnogorska plovidba to navigate their financial struggles. He supports government plans for cooperation, believing that this strategic partnership will help both companies avoid similar financial predicaments in the future while outlining Barska's own operational plans to maintain liquidity.
